CJ.com Releases API, Web Services Center

ValueClick Inc’s (VCLK) Commission Junction, one of the most well-known affiliate networks, has announced the release of Web Services APIs for their publishers. The new APIs, Publisher Commission Report and the Real-Time Commission Report, enable publishers to pull daily and real-time commission data respectively in the specific formats they need to move their businesses forward.

The Web Services Center has quite a few sample tools. One sample, contextual ads, is fairly new to the affiliate mix. Traditionally, contextual ads have been associated with pay-per-click and CPM advertising. However, it pulls keywords from the meta data, not page content. Another hurdle is that if you are not registered into the program that’s displayed in the advertisement, you will not get paid.

It’s great that CJ.com has FINALLY released something that allows developers to harness their huge advertiser database. I expect to see some pretty cool things come from this - if only they would promote it a little more.
